Former Ashgold striker and captain Shafiu Mumuni has denied media reports that he has signed a contract with Ghana Premier League side Dreams FC.

The striker is now a free agent after failing to agree fresh terms with Obuasi Ashantigold ahead of the new campaign.

News went viral in the local media on Wednesday that the lethal finisher has signed for the Dawu based side but the striker has denied those claims.

According to the player, there are several clubs from France, Spain, Portugal and Asante Kotoko all chasing his signature and insists he has not held any talks with anyone from Dreams FC.

He told Kumasi based Oyerepa Fm that he has not signed for the Ghana Premier League side.

''It's not true, i have not spoken to anyone at Dreams. There are suitors from France,Spain and Portugal and in Ghana Kotoko is also around. It's not true am joining Dreams FC," he added.
